How Much Does it Cost to Install a Kill Switch? A Comprehensive Guide
Installing a kill switch can significantly enhance your vehicle's security, offering peace of mind against theft. But before you rush into it, understanding the cost is crucial. This guide breaks down the various factors influencing the price of a kill switch installation.
Factors Affecting Kill Switch Installation Costs
Several elements contribute to the overall cost of installing a kill switch in your vehicle. These include:
1. Type of Kill Switch:
The complexity and features of the kill switch itself directly impact the price. Simple, basic kill switches are generally cheaper than more sophisticated models with advanced features like remote activation or hidden placements. Consider:
- Basic On/Off Switch: These are the most affordable options and often involve a simple wiring modification.
- Remote-Activated Kill Switch: These offer greater convenience and security, but come with a higher price tag due to the additional components and installation complexity.
- Hidden Kill Switches: Strategically concealing the kill switch adds to the installation time and cost. The more intricate the hiding spot, the higher the price.
2. Vehicle Type and Complexity:
The make, model, and year of your vehicle play a role. Some vehicles have more accessible wiring harnesses, making the installation quicker and cheaper. Others might require more extensive dismantling and specialized knowledge, leading to increased labor costs. Older vehicles might also present unexpected wiring challenges that drive up the cost.
3. Labor Costs:
Labor costs vary greatly depending on your location and the chosen installer. Professional mechanics or specialized security installers generally charge higher hourly rates than amateur installers. Shop around and compare quotes from multiple sources to find the best value.
4. Additional Components:
The installation might necessitate additional components beyond the kill switch itself. This could include wiring harnesses, relays, or other electronic parts depending on the chosen kill switch type and your vehicle's specific requirements. These extra parts add to the overall expense.
Cost Estimates
While providing exact pricing is impossible without specifics, here's a general range:
-
Basic Kill Switch Installation: You might expect to pay anywhere from $50 to $150 for a simple installation by a professional. DIY installation could potentially reduce the cost to the price of the kill switch itself (often under $50).
-
Advanced Kill Switch Installation (Remote, Hidden): More complex installations can range from $150 to $500 or more, depending on the complexity of the system and the labor involved.
DIY vs. Professional Installation: Weighing the Pros and Cons
Installing a kill switch yourself can save you money, but requires some mechanical aptitude and comfort with automotive wiring. If you're not confident in your abilities, hiring a professional installer is recommended to ensure proper installation and prevent potential damage to your vehicle's electrical system. A professional installation also provides peace of mind and a warranty on their work.
Choosing the Right Installer
When selecting an installer, consider:
- Experience: Choose an installer with experience in vehicle security systems.
- Reputation: Check online reviews and testimonials to gauge their reliability and quality of work.
- Warranty: Ensure they offer a warranty on their work to cover any potential issues.
- Transparency: Inquire about the total cost upfront, including parts and labor, to avoid unexpected charges.
